Nokia&Orange partnership for mobile email

Today Nokia and Orange announced that they will continue their strategic partnership for mobile email. This is good news for Nokia E75 fans.

The E75 users will have access to the built push email but also other 30 Nokia signature devices. The two companies have started back in February 2008 and they will launch it this summer. First country that will benefit from it will be the UK . After this France and Spain will follow.

Orange customers will be able access up to 10 email accounts via the  home screen. They will receive, send and reply to emails and all that on your mobile phone. Several major markets will be enjoying Nokia Messaging in 2009 with pricing and tariffs announced locally by Orange.
